What teams are playing in the Frisco Bowl?

FRISCO, TEXAS — San Diego State (11-2), representing the Mountain West Conference, and UTSA (12-1), representing Conference USA, will meet in the 2021 Tropical Smoothie Cafe Frisco Bowl on Tuesday, Dec. 21, at 6:30 p.m. CT at Toyota Stadium in Frisco, Texas. The game will air on ESPN.

Who plays in Toyota Stadium in Frisco TX?

The 145-acre multipurpose sports and entertainment facility sits at the intersection of Main Street and the Dallas North Tollway in Frisco, Texas. It is the home stadium for FC Dallas, hosts the FCS title game and the Tropical Smoothie Cafe Frisco Bowl as well a variety of concerts, tournaments and other events.

What bowl game is in Frisco Texas?

The Frisco Bowl
The Frisco Bowl is an annual college bowl game played in Frisco, Texas at Toyota Stadium. The bowl game is owned and operated by ESPN Events, a division of ESPN, and is affiliated with all Group of Five conferences. The Frisco Bowl will air in December 2022 from Toyota Stadium.

Why is UTSA playing in the Frisco Bowl?

UTSA originally was selected to play in the Frisco Bowl last year but ended up switching to the First Responder Bowl after the Frisco Bowl was cancelled due to COVID-19 protocols within the SMU program.

Is the Frisco Football Classic a bowl?

The 2021 Frisco Football Classic was a college football bowl game played on December 23, 2021, in Frisco, Texas, with kickoff at 3:30 p.m. ET (2:30 p.m. CT local time), televised on ESPN. It was one of the 2021–22 bowl games concluding the 2021 FBS football season.

Is FBS or FCS better?

FBS teams are allowed a maximum of 85 players receiving athletically based aid per year, with each player on scholarship receiving a full scholarship. FCS teams have the same 85-player limit as FBS teams, but are allowed to give aid equivalent to only 63 full scholarships.

What is the difference between FCS and FBS?

It stands for Football Championship Subdivision and was known as Division I-AA from 1978-2005. The main difference between FBS and FCS is how a final winner is determined. The FBS has the four-team College Football Playoff while the FCS hosts a 24-team playoff for the NCAA D-I Football Championship.

Who owns FC Dallas?

Hunt Sports Group
A member of Major League Soccer since its inception in 1996, FC Dallas is owned and operated by Hunt Sports Group. The professional team plays from March to October at Toyota Stadium in Frisco, Texas.
